What these numbers mean
Evidence, not a promise.
The model produced better probabilistic scores than the specified constant baseline over this historical sample.
Brier and log-loss measure probability quality. They do not represent betting profit or guaranteed correct selections.
Timestamped historical bookmaker odds are unavailable, so this report does not claim backtested profitability.
Teams, competitions and market conditions change. Historical evidence cannot guarantee future performance.
